Versions对比工具
**Versions对比工具** Versions是一款强大的版本控制系统客户端,它支持多种版本控制系统,如Subversion (SVN) 和Git。在日常的代码管理和协作中,对比工具是必不可少的组件,用于查看和理解不同版本之间的差异。Versions内置了对比工具,使得用户可以直观地看到文件或目录在不同版本间的改动。 **安装及配置p4merge** p4merge是一款由Perforce公司开发的可视化三向合并工具,它被广泛用于解决代码冲突和比较文件差异。在Versions中,用户可以选择p4merge作为默认的外部对比工具,以利用其强大的对比功能。以下是安装和配置p4merge的步骤: 1. **下载与安装p4merge**:你需要从Perforce官方网站下载适用于你操作系统(如Mac OS X、Windows或Linux)的p4merge安装包,并按照指示完成安装。 2. **验证安装**:安装完成后,启动p4merge应用程序,确保它能正常运行并显示对比界面。 3. **配置Versions**:在Versions中,打开“偏好设置”(Preferences),然后选择“通用”(General)或“外部工具”(External Tools)选项卡。在这里,你会找到“差异”(Diff)和“三向合并”(Merge)的设置。 4. **指定p4merge路径**:在相应的字段中,输入p4merge应用程序的完整路径。例如,在Mac上,这可能是`/Applications/p4merge.app/Contents/MacOS/p4merge`。确保路径正确无误,点击“确定”保存设置。 5. **测试配置**:现在,你可以选择两个版本的文件在Versions中进行比较,如果配置正确,p4merge应该会启动并显示文件差异。 **p4merge的主要功能** - **双栏对比**:p4merge提供了左右两栏展示不同版本的文件,可以清晰地看到每一行的变化。 - **三栏对比**:对于解决合并冲突,p4merge提供三栏视图,显示基线版本、你的版本和另一方的版本,帮助你理解并解决冲突。 - **颜色编码**:通过颜色编码,p4merge突出显示新增、删除和修改的文本,使得差异一目了然。 - **全屏模式**:为了更好地专注于对比,p4merge支持全屏模式,最大化查看空间。 - **复制和粘贴**:用户可以直接在对比窗口中选择并复制差异部分到剪贴板,方便编辑和比较。 - **保存合并结果**:完成合并操作后,p4merge允许你保存合并后的文件,以便于提交到版本库。 通过集成p4merge,Versions能够提供更强大、更直观的文件对比体验,帮助开发者高效地管理代码版本和解决冲突。无论是简单的差异查看还是复杂的合并操作,p4merge都是一个值得信赖的工具。
- 1
- 粉丝: 0
- 资源: 1
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- MQTT协议的原理、特点、工作流程及应用场景
- Ruby语言教程从介绍入门到精通详教程跟代码.zip
- PM2.5-Prediction-Based-on-Random-Forest-Algorithm-master.zip
- Delphi开发详解:从入门到高级全面教程
- 物理机安装群晖DS3617教程(用U盘做引导)
- 使用jQuery实现一个加购物车飞入动画
- 本项目旨在开发一个基于情感词典加权组合方式的文本情感分析系统,通过以下几个目标来实现: 构建情感词典:收集并整理包含情感极性(正面或负面)的词汇 加权组合:通过加权机制,根据词汇在文本中的重要性、
- Visual Basic从入门到精通:基础知识与实践指南
- 炫酷文本粒子threejs特效
- hreejs地球世界轮廓线条动画